What is Great Stuff?
Established in 1980, Great Stuff has evolved into a cornerstone of the Westchester and Fairfield county retail landscapes. The company operates as a high-end specialty boutique, curating a sophisticated selection of apparel, jewelry, and accessories tailored for both casual and formal demographics. By maintaining a presence in key affluent markets such as Scarsdale, Rye, Chappaqua, Greenwich, and Westport, the firm has cultivated a loyal customer base that prioritizes personalized service and unique product offerings.
